Skip to content

Commit

Permalink
downloads: Add entry for NixOS owned by maralorn
Browse files Browse the repository at this point in the history
  • Loading branch information
maralorn committed May 21, 2022
1 parent 089dd67 commit 36cb0d0
Showing 1 changed file with 12 additions and 0 deletions.
12 changes: 12 additions & 0 deletions site/downloads.markdown
Original file line number Diff line number Diff line change
Expand Up @@ -71,6 +71,18 @@ Alternatively, many operating systems provide GHC, cabal and Stack through their

**Do not use the Haskell development tools provided by Arch, they are broken.** For more information see [[1]](https://dixonary.co.uk/blog/haskell/cabal-2020) [[2]](https://stackoverflow.com/questions/65643699/what-is-the-suggested-way-of-setting-up-haskell-on-archlinux/65644318#65644318).

#### NixOS

[](This installation method is owned by @maralorn)

* [Documentation for Haskell development and packaging with nix](https://haskell4nix.readthedocs.io/nixpkgs-users-guide.html#how-to-create-a-development-environment)
* **Using ghcup on NixOS does not work.** Use the official packages instead.
* Official packages
[GHC](https://search.nixos.org/packages?show=ghc&type=packages&query=ghc),
[cabal](https://search.nixos.org/packages?show=cabal-install&type=packages&query=cabal-install),
[HLS](https://search.nixos.org/packages?show=haskell-language-server&type=packages&query=haskell-language-server),
[Stack](https://search.nixos.org/packages?show=stack&type=packages&query=stack)

</div>

<p><a data-toggle="collapse" href="#collapse-freebsd" class="btn btn-xs btn-primary">Show FreeBSD packages</a></p>
Expand Down

0 comments on commit 36cb0d0

Please sign in to comment.